The industry of the stone floor has an impact& on our environment, it directly by the management of quarries for approvisionement in raw materials, management of waste, or indirectly, by his its energy consumption, in production or in transport. Today, at the time of the globalization, a lot of manufacturers do not hesitate to delocalize their productions in countries where the workforce is of lesser cost. The impact on the selling price of the stone floor is undeniable, but at what ecological and human price? It is not rare today to find labelings disturbing as "IMPORTED FROM ITALY" and further away"made in PRC". Disconcerting, isn't it! All this to come to the initiative of the European Union there concerning industrial products made in Europe, having for object to value products made by a network of companies which make a commitment to respect the standards Eco-label, putting the ecology in the center of their statégies of growth. The road is still long before being able to buy a stone floor which would not have polluted. But be realistic, require the impossible!
The eco-label exists since 1992 and is now open to ceramic covers, under the category Hard Floor Coverings.
